MapTools.org

[Chameleon] Extract WFS Data

Bart van den Eijnden bartvde@xs4all.nl
Mon, 22 Mar 2004 20:04:37 +0100
Hi,

good to hear it is working now.

I only have a Windows binary of php_ogr, and I don't know if the source 
code is (already) available through the Maptools CVS.

Hopefully DM Solutions can comment on this one.

Best regards,
Bart

On Mon, 22 Mar 2004 11:01:16 -0800 (PST), we wei <mapgisnewbies@yahoo.com> 
wrote:

> Hi Bart,
>
> The second one work for me.  And i guess I accidently
> use mapserver-4.0 in the connection string of the map
> file.  That's why I couldn't make it get GML because
> the executewfsgetfeature method is missing in
> php_mapscript.c of version 4.0 of mapserver.  So,
> right now, it is working.  Thanks a lot for you help
> :)
>
> And I got another question about extract WFS data in
> shape file.  I noticed that my php_ogr.so is missing.
> Do you know where I can get or how can I build it?  I
> am on Linux Redhat 9 perform.
>
> Thanks,
> Wei
>
>
>
>
> --- Bart van den Eijnden <bartvde@xs4all.nl> wrote:
>> Hi,
>>
>> it should work if you use a properly configured
>> sample_wms_wfs_client.map
>> in your Chameleon application.
>>
>> Try the following (for WMS layers):
>>
>> 1) perform a DescribeLayer request on the road
>> layer, i.e.
>>
> http://localhost/cgi-bin/mapserv_41.exe?map=/ms4w/apps/geodan_sample/map/sample_wms_wfs_server.map&request=DescribeLayer&layers=road&version=1.1.1
>>
>> does this work?
>>
>> if 1) works try (as the OnlineResource part you
>> should normally take the
>> response from request 1, but as Mapserver is WMS and
>> WFS in one, the
>> OnlineResource is normally the same):
>>
>> 2)
>>
> http://localhost/cgi-bin/mapserv_41.exe?map=/ms4w/apps/geodan_sample/map/sample_wms_wfs_server.map&request=GetFeature&typename=road&service=WFS&version=1.0.0
>>
>> Do you get GML?
>>
>> This is the exact same way the ExtractWFSData would
>> try to get its GML
>>  from a WMS Layer. So I suspect 1) and 2) won't both
>> work.
>>
>> Best regards,
>> Bart
>>
>> On Mon, 22 Mar 2004 09:33:42 -0800 (PST), we wei
>> <mapgisnewbies@yahoo.com>
>> wrote:
>>
>> > Hi all,
>> >
>> > I have a question about using Extract WFS Data in
>> > Chameleon 1.1 alpha 6 sample application.  I tried
>> to
>> > see the actiion of this widget.  But when I click
>> > extract button on the pop-up window of Extract WFS
>> > Data, I got the following error:
>> >
>> > "Invalid layer or none selected.  Please ensure
>> that
>> > the selected layer is WMS or WFS layer"
>> >
>> > Then I look in sample.map file and it doesn't not
>> seem
>> > to have any WFS layer.  So, I changed to use
>> > sample_wms_wfs_server.map and
>> > sample_wms_wfs_client.map; however, I still got
>> the
>> > above error.
>> >
>> > I guess I may setup something wrongly.
>> >
>> > Could anyone give some hints to me so that I could
>> > make this functionality work ?
>> >
>> > Any help would be greatly appreciated.
>> >
>> > Thanks in advance.
>> >
>> >
>> > __________________________________
>> > Do you Yahoo!?
>> > Yahoo! Finance Tax Center - File online. File on
>> time.
>> > http://taxes.yahoo.com/filing.html
>> > _______________________________________________
>> > Chameleon mailing list
>> > Chameleon@lists.maptools.org
>> >
>> http://lists.maptools.org/mailman/listinfo/chameleon
>> >
>>
>>
>>
>> --
>>
>> _______________________________________________
>> Chameleon mailing list
>> Chameleon@lists.maptools.org
>> http://lists.maptools.org/mailman/listinfo/chameleon
>
>
> __________________________________
> Do you Yahoo!?
> Yahoo! Finance Tax Center - File online. File on time.
> http://taxes.yahoo.com/filing.html
>



-- 
  


This archive was generated by Pipermail.